Technical Specifications

Side-by-side comparison of GeForce RTX 3060 Ti and Radeon RX 5600 XT

NVIDIA

GeForce RTX 3060 Ti

The GeForce RTX 3060 Ti is manufactured by NVIDIA. It was released in December 1 2020. It features the Ampere architecture. The core clock ranges from 1410 MHz to 1665 MHz. It has 4864 shading units. The thermal design power (TDP) is 200W. Manufactured using 8 nm process technology. It features 38 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 20,312 points. Launch price was $399.

AMD

Radeon RX 5600 XT

The Radeon RX 5600 XT is manufactured by AMD. It was released in January 21 2020. It features the RDNA 1.0 architecture. The core clock ranges from 1130 MHz to 1560 MHz. It has 2304 shading units. The thermal design power (TDP) is 150W. Manufactured using 7 nm process technology. G3D Mark benchmark score: 13,453 points. Launch price was $279.

Graphics Performance

In G3D Mark, the GeForce RTX 3060 Ti scores 20,312 versus the Radeon RX 5600 XT's 13,453 — the GeForce RTX 3060 Ti leads by 51%. The GeForce RTX 3060 Ti is built on Ampere while the Radeon RX 5600 XT uses RDNA 1.0, both on 8 nm vs 7 nm. Shader units: 4,864 (GeForce RTX 3060 Ti) vs 2,304 (Radeon RX 5600 XT). Raw compute: 16.2 TFLOPS (GeForce RTX 3060 Ti) vs 7.188 TFLOPS (Radeon RX 5600 XT). Boost clocks: 1665 MHz vs 1560 MHz.

Video Memory (VRAM)

The GeForce RTX 3060 Ti comes with 8 GB of VRAM, while the Radeon RX 5600 XT has 6 GB. The GeForce RTX 3060 Ti offers 33.3% more capacity, crucial for higher resolutions and texture-heavy games. Memory bandwidth: 448 GB/s (GeForce RTX 3060 Ti) vs 336 GB/s (Radeon RX 5600 XT) — a 33.3% advantage for the GeForce RTX 3060 Ti. Bus width: 256-bit vs 192-bit. L2 Cache: 4 MB (GeForce RTX 3060 Ti) vs 3 MB (Radeon RX 5600 XT) — the GeForce RTX 3060 Ti has significantly larger on-die cache to reduce VRAM reliance.

Power & Dimensions

The GeForce RTX 3060 Ti draws 200W versus the Radeon RX 5600 XT's 150W — a 28.6% difference. The Radeon RX 5600 XT is more power-efficient. Recommended PSU: 600W (GeForce RTX 3060 Ti) vs 450W (Radeon RX 5600 XT). Power connectors: 8-pin vs 8-pin. Card length: 242mm vs 267mm, occupying 2 vs 2 slots. Typical load temperature: 75 vs 75°C.
